Output d27781348912cc7b9e1ea5efb1e3d40b94fed40a68afa03d893312f54671f425:0

value
17576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ac60ed2bc0b21517d7e85321cab35dccc0c8be3 OP_EQUAL
address
3CtBdFY2vaZP2GufrhDR6jnwPtrh9kQaFh
transaction
d27781348912cc7b9e1ea5efb1e3d40b94fed40a68afa03d893312f54671f425
spent
false

1 Sat Range